How To Remove Wrinkles From Leather Jackets?

Leather jackets are a timeless wardrobe staple, and like all clothing, they also require some care and maintenance to keep them looking their best. However, leather jackets can be tricky to care for, especially when they develop wrinkles over time, especially if they're stored in a cramped closet. Here are some tips on how to remove wrinkles from leather jackets so you can keep wearing them for years to come.
Remove wrinkles from leather jackets by hanging them

Hang your leather jacket in a closet or on a clothes hanger. If you don't have space to hang it, lay the jacket flat on a clean surface. The weight of the jacket will use gravity to pull out the wrinkles. For best results, hang the jacket in a well-ventilated room and allow it to air out for a day or two before wearing it. This will help loosen and remove any wrinkles in the fabric.

Use a steam iron on leather jackets

If you need to remove wrinkles from your leather jacket quickly, try using a steam iron. Be sure to set the iron to the lowest heat setting possible so you don't damage the jacket. Place a clean towel over the jacket before you iron it, and hold the iron about six inches away from the surface of the fabric. Slowly move the iron back and forth over the towel until the wrinkles begin to disappear.
Use a hairdryer on leather jackets

If you don't have an iron, you can also use a hairdryer to remove wrinkles from your leather jacket. Set the hair dryer to the lowest heat setting and hold it about six inches away from the jacket. Slowly move the hairdryer back and forth over the surface of the fabric until the wrinkles start to disappear.

Tips for preventing wrinkles on leather jackets
The following are some tips for preventing wrinkled leather or significantly slowing down the wrinkling process:
Use good-quality hangers
Invest in wide-shoulder wooden hangers. These hangers provide ample support for the jacket, distribute weight evenly, and prevent the jacket from slipping off. As a result, they help to keep the jacket looking smooth and wrinkle-free.
Keep using leather conditioner
Leather conditioner helps to prevent wrinkles by lubricating the fibers and keeping them supple. Apply it every few weeks or as needed to maintain the jacket's appearance.
Always use a garment bag while travelling
Travelling can be tough on your clothes, especially when packing leather jackets. To protect your jacket while travelling, use a garment bag. It prevents your jacket from being squished in a suitcase and protects it from other items that could cause it to wrinkle.

Does real leather crease?
Yes, leather is a natural product, and as it ages, it will naturally crease.
Why is my leather jacket wrinkled?
Leather is a natural, porous material that will wrinkle over time. The amount of wrinkling and the rate at which it occurs depend on several factors, including the type of leather, its frequency of use, and the extent to which it's exposed to the elements. -
Can you get creases out of leather?
Yes, you can get creases out of leather. You can use a hairdryer on the cool setting to help loosen the leather and gently push out the creases. -
Can you steam a leather jacket to get the wrinkles out?
Yes, you can steam a leather jacket to get the wrinkles out. Be sure to use a steamer with a dedicated leather nozzle, and hold the steamer about six inches away from the surface of the jacket. Slowly move the steamer back and forth over the wrinkled area until the wrinkles dissipate. Be careful not to over-steam, as this could cause damage to the leather.
